Oli Nelson is a product engineer and technical founder based in Sydney with eight years building full-stack web products and founding a niche edtech startup. He currently splits his time between product engineering at Uscreen and running Maestrocast, a platform that makes online music teaching delightful by combining live annotation, camera control and lesson management. Oli’s background blends a formal music performance degree with immersive software engineering training, giving him a rare mix of UX empathy and practical engineering discipline. He has shipped features across startups and SMEs—from real-time education tools to enterprise-facing systems—often taking ideas from prototype to production. Known as a “digital renaissance man” on GitHub, he brings hands-on curiosity and a doer’s mindset to both code and product strategy. Colleagues describe him as entrepreneurial, detail-oriented, and especially attuned to the needs of creative users.
